SOC 1110 - Introduction to Sociological Thinking



Goals: To introduce students to the basic sociological concepts. To show how these concepts are used to analyze society. To increase our knowledge of how society is organized and operates. To encourage creative and critical thinking.

Content: Study of culture, socialization, social institutions such as the family, religion, and government, race, gender, social class, and social change.

Taught: Annually, fall, winter and spring terms.

Credits: 4
